What Your Job Will Be Like
Are you a passionate about the business of preserving, organizing, and accessing incredibly valuable history, conducting research, and serving as a steward to preserve institutional memory? Become our next Records Management Professional and serve as a Sandia National Laboratories (SNL) archivist!
On any given day, you may be called on to:
- Appraise, acquire, arrange, describe, preserve, and make available the archives of the Laboratories
- Maintain physical and intellectual control of the Laboratories' institutional collections using established archival methodologies
- Handle institutional, organizational, programmatic or facility records, including submittal, receipt, transfer, storage, research, retrieval, usage, and disposition
- Service as a steward to preserve institutional memory
- Research the corporate archival collection in response to legal holds, technical staff research, internal and external audit, Freedom of Information Acts (FOIA) requests, and investigative requests from a variety of external entities
- Work with various programs and employees to transfer historically significant collections into the Archives and collaborate with experts as necessary to review, analyze, and catalog all information according to National Archives and Records Administration (NARA), U.S. Department of Energy/National Nuclear Security Administration (DOE/NNSA) and SNL policies and procedures
- Set up and/or maintain systems of written, photographic, or video record cataloging, storage, and retrieval
- Establish and maintain relationships with NARA and DOE/NNSA to ensure compliance with federal regulations
- Lead all aspects of and ensure transfer of permanent records to NARA
- Promote visibility and usage of the Archives through outreach, instruction, training, and presentations
- Partner with information technology professionals on the design and implementation of corporate and local information solutions for the long-term storage, preservation, and migration of digital records

Security Clearance
Sandia is required by DOE to conduct a pre-employment drug test and background review that includes checks of personal references, credit, law enforcement records, and employment/education verifications. Applicants for employment need to be able to obtain and maintain a DOE Q-level security clearance, which requires U.S. citizenship. If you hold more than one citizenship (i.e., of the U.S. and another country), your ability to obtain a security clearance may be impacted.
Applicants offered employment with Sandia are subject to a federal background investigation to meet the requirements for access to classified information or matter if the duties of the position require a DOE security clearance. Substance abuse or illegal drug use, falsification of information, criminal activity, serious misconduct or other indicators of untrustworthiness can cause a clearance to be denied or terminated by DOE, resulting in the inability to perform the duties assigned and subsequent termination of employment.
